Foreign Minister Yair Lapid issues his first response to tonight’s terror attack.

“A very difficult evening. Violent and cruel terrorism harms innocent civilians.”

“My heart goes out to the families receiving the hardest news tonight. I send wishes for a speedy recovery to the wounded and wish to strengthen their families,” Lapid says.

“The State of Israel is strong, we will fight terrorism with force and determination. The security forces face tense days ahead of them. I strengthen them and pray that they will return home in peace.”
